Compare Dana Point to Milpitas

This post compares Dana Point, California to Milpitas,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Dana Point (city) Milpitas (city)
Population 34,028 75,498
Income (median) $70,677 $66,537
Home Value (median) $833,800 $704,300
White 83% 16%
Black 1% 3%
Asian 3% 66%
With Kids 22% 41%
Age (median) 48 36
Rentals 39% 35%
